Quote:

I am not convinced as to why D is incorrect …how does it matter if restaurant managers oversee both food storage and cooking? As long as a course makes them better at food handling (which includes storage I guess), that should prevent them from violating serious health codes…so how is this option not a strengthener ?
It's very important in these questions to understand the author's logic - How is he saying the effectiveness is demonstrated? - by telling 1/3 of the restaurant managers have taken such a course and only 8% of restaurant cited for serious heath violation were managed by these trained people. So, in his mind he would be thinking that if the course was not effective, around 33% managers would have been managing the restaurant that were cited for violation but that's not the case, so the course is effective. Option D doesn't strengthen author's logic at all.

Hi everyone, my name is Akshat Srivastava. Five years of on-and-off prep, no paid course or tutor (the GMAT Club tests and adaptive quizzes I use are redeemed with GMAT Club points, and GMAT Ninja’s Wednesday sessions are free), and one official mock sitting at 625. I got tired of guessing why, so I exported my whole error log and sliced it by difficulty, failure mode, answer-choice bias, and time of day.

Three things came out that I honestly can’t tell are real signal or just me fooling myself:


On Data Sufficiency, I pick "C" on 47% of my misses. C is right only 16% of the time. Almost half my DS errors are one reflex.
A full year of logging, and my Hard-level accuracy hasn’t actually climbed. Volume looks like it just plateaued me.
When I model the swing between sessions, a single mock turns out to be ~70% noise. My good days and bad days move far more than sampling alone should allow.


The whole thing is in the attached report: the difficulty matrix with confidence intervals, the DS and CR breakdowns, the time-of-day effect, and the variance math behind that last point. It opens in any browser. Here is the link :

https://claude.ai/public/artifacts/6bed ... 5748feb1ad

What I’m after isn’t applause, it’s holes. If you’ve crossed 700, are these the levers that actually moved your score, or am I chasing the wrong things? Tell me where I’m reading my own data wrong.
